Output d94306926436793df75f31ed73311899809af48c279a52df4bf7436dd5f7f6e3:1

value
676856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b753c870b0b81dd860306c4806941142fc7d4a69 OP_EQUAL
address
3JQMwzTekfoaoaov57kmGwwbHtoEa4vmx9
transaction
d94306926436793df75f31ed73311899809af48c279a52df4bf7436dd5f7f6e3
spent
true